기술

OSI 7 Layer

개복치 개발자 2021. 8. 24. 05:25

 

 학교다닐 때 네트워크 수업들을 때 한번 들어봤던 내용입니다.

 

 학교다닐 때는 이게 도대체 뭔소리야? 라고 생각했는데 너무 쉽게 설명해주는 영상이 있어 한번 정리해봤습니다.

 

https://www.youtube.com/watch?v=1pfTxp25MA8 

 

 1계층 - 물리계층 (Physical layer)

 

 컴퓨터와 컴퓨터끼리 연결해서 아날로그 신호를 통해서 0과 1을 전달해줍니다.

 

 2계층 - 데이터 링크 계층(Data-Link Layer)

 

 라우터(스위치)를 통해서 컴퓨터들을 연결해줘서 데이터를 전달합니다.

 

 여러 데이터가 섞이지 않게 앞뒤로 숫자를 붙여서 구분할 수 있는데 이를 Framing이라고 합니다.

 

 3계층 - 네트워크 계층(Network Layer)

 

 수많은 네트워크로 이루어진 연결 속에 IP주소를 이용해서 길을 찾아서 다음 라우터에게 값을 넘겨줍니다.

 

 4계층 - 전송계층(Transport Layer)

 

  데이터가 도착했지만, 어디로 연결해줄지 port를 이용해서 최종적으로 도달하게 하는 곳

 

 5,6,7 계층 - 응용 계층(Application Layer) - TCP/IP 모델 

 

  HTTP 통신을 통해서 데이터 전달

'기술' 카테고리의 다른 글

프로토콜 버퍼란?  (0) 2022.12.01
객체지향의 원칙  (0) 2021.10.20
Heap Stack  (0) 2021.09.27
DB Index  (0) 2021.08.14
프로세스(Process)와 쓰레드(Thread)의 차이  (0) 2021.08.13